Joel Guegel

Fantastic! My family and I came in here and we basically played musical plates, passing each other's dishes around cause everything was delicious! Extremely sweet hostess, and just an overall good experience.

Couple things to note:
1. Parking in the area sucks. Not the restaurants fault but trying to find a spot took several U-turns.
2. The inside of the restaurant is tiny. There's only 5 tables; 4 on one single long booth, and then a single table for 6. I'm only saying this so you're aware if you happen to be coming in with a party of 4 or more.

Would highly recommend! Best breakfast/lunch we've had since coming to Seattle!
